April 7th, World Health Day
7th of April 2008
April the 7th marks all over the date when the World Health Organization was prestigiously founded and watches over our health.
Every year this celebration gets the attention over an issue that concerns WHO and that can have one of the most tragic consequences over the humanity, topics that generally need an urgent and focused approached from the world's states.
2008 is the year when the international medical forum gets the attention over the important changes of the global warming and environment and especially over the tragic impact that these might have on the health of the planet's inhabitants.
The priority theme of this year, "health protection by the effects of the climate changes ", provides a reflection topic on the global warming context that we live in and on the consequences already visible on the health status, longevity, pathology, etc.
All these started to be a problem and a serious threat over the past years. The solution consists in coordinated approach of the global warming issue as some intervention measures could be identified by the international community:
- Strengthening and developing the control and prevention systems for infectious diseases;
- Rational use of the resources such as water, especially the drinking water - already in decrease - that can seriously affect the health of the population;
- Coordination and strengthen the activities meant to maintain and even to improve the health status.
The main objective that WHO proposes for the April 7th celebration of this year is the catalysis of international community's efforts to organize and involve in a global campaign of limiting the effects over health produced by the global warming changes.
Another priority objective of WHO is represented by including the topic of medical consequences of the global warming effects on the work agenda of the United Nations.
The measures undertaken to reach these objectives might create the necessary conditions for the governments and non-governmental institutions to get in the attention of the public opinion the issues and health problems caused by global warming.
The foreseen result would be the one to involve a big number of people and communities in the efforts of settling down the global warming and to limit the negative changes over the past years.Moreover, might be the moment to mobilize the existent resources for carrying out an advocacy campaign that would plead for urgent and real involvement of the governments, communities, civil society and even the population in implementing these measures.
A high attention shall be paid to the protection of vulnerable population, especially the one from the African continent, extremely affected and marked by the past years incidents.In the same, this can be an opportunity to establish a connection and a common approach regarding other fields that need a constructive approach, such as environment, food resources, energy and transports.
The objectives and the activities that WHO proposes in 2008 are various and very generous:
- An in depth understanding and increase of the involvement level of the population in the control of the local and global consequences of the global warming changes;
- Advocacy strategies that would plead for establishing some intersectional and interdisciplinary partnerships at a local and international level. The purpose of these partnerships is to settle down and to minimize the impact of the present global warming over our health status;
- Initiation of some specific activities within communities, organizations, health systems and governments in order to urgent apply some concrete and feasible measures to protect health;
- Proving the role that the preoccupation for community's health has in confronting with these kind of challenges, at a global, regional, national and community level;
- To inspire the governments, international organizations, donors, civil societies, business environment and communities, especially youngsters, with the decision of anchoring the health problem in the work agenda of the forums that approach the effects of the global warming.
